We needed a homework station and a place for my kids to play on the computers so they stop using mine. haha! We had this awkward nook in our basement right off of our family room and we wanted to do something useful and we knew our kids desperately needed a place to both study and play.

How to create a homework station

First, I painted the walls white. Then, I taped off 2/3 of the way down the wall and painted the bottom part with a rich navy blue, the same navy I’ve used throughout my house. My husband and I started by building this kid’s desk (tutorial coming soon!) and finished it off with some furnishings from Ikea.
